What does intermittent time mean?

< Back to Leave of Absence. When medically necessary, an intermittent leave may require an employee to take time off in separate periods of time due to a single illness or injury as determined by the health care provider of the individual, rather than one continuous period of time.

How often do you eat on intermittent fasting?

The 16/8 method involves fasting every day for about 16 hours and restricting your daily eating window to approximately 8 hours. Within the eating window, you can fit in two, three, or more meals.

What is intermittent rainfall?

Intermittent or continuous precipitation falls from stratiform clouds (As, Ns, St, Sc) which cover the whole sky or nearly so. … Intermittent and continuous precipitation are characterised by gradual changes of intensity.

What is the difference between intermittent and occasional?

As adjectives the difference between intermittent and occasional. is that intermittent is stopping and starting at intervals; coming after a particular time span; not steady or constant while occasional is occurring or appearing irregularly from time to time.

Is Sporadic the same as intermittent?

Sporadic: Occuring but with no regular pattern. Intermittent: Occuring over a period of time with small gaps in between.
